What does Sophos’ Web Filtering allow administrators to do?

Change user passwords

Set policies to restrict or allow access to specific categories of websites

Sophos' Web Filtering feature provides administrators with the ability to establish policies that specifically restrict or allow access to certain categories of websites. This functionality is crucial for organizations that wish to maintain a safe browsing environment for their users, as it helps in blocking undesirable content while allowing access to appropriate resources.

By setting these policies, administrators can tailor web access according to the organization's guidelines and regulatory requirements, ensuring that employees can use the internet effectively without exposing themselves or the organization to unnecessary risks. This capability supports not only security objectives but also enhances productivity by preventing access to non-work-related sites.

The other options do not relate directly to the core function of web filtering within the Sophos framework. For example, changing user passwords pertains to account management, creating network traffic reports falls under monitoring and analytics, and unrestricted monitoring of user activity addresses privacy and compliance issues rather than web content regulation. Thus, the ability to set web access policies stands out as the primary function of Sophos’ Web Filtering.
